Financial Research Service’s Distribution of Copyrighted Recording of Earnings Call Was Fair Use, Says Second Circuit

Summary: In a significant decision addressing copyright fair use, the Second Circuit held that a financial research service’s dissemination of a copyrighted recording of a company’s earnings call with investors was fair use. In addition to its expansive view of fair use, the court’s decision is noteworthy in that it affirmed the district court’s sua sponte grant of summary judgment before the plaintiff had the opportunity to take any discovery.
